The original “Villaggio Solvay” was built after the Solvay company set up a factory for the production of soda. The houses were built on the Belgian model and are of nine different typologies; number 1 for the director, no. 2 (absent at Rosignano Solvay) and no. 3 for executives, from no. 4 to no. 8 for white-collar workers, no. 9 for workmen. The plans were drawn up and signed by the Solvay technical office, though Belgian architect Jules Brunfault is considered the inspirer also because the typologies are the same as the villages built in Belgium and France. |
